Contemporary Approaches to Environmental Studies of Urban Open Spaces

Abstract:
Open space is an ill-defined concept in that it is understood differently by different people. However a variety of different authors have used a range of definitions relating to open space. This study assesses the current urban open space in English language papers published in related journals by searching electronic database of ScienceDirect. The period of analysis is limited to the articles appearing between 2000 to 2010. In order to review contemporary approaches in scientific journals, research papers published in English language journals on UOS were obtained by searching electronic database of Science Direct. Keywords used for the search were ‘open space’, ‘public open space’, ‘urban open space’, and ‘outdoor space’ and these were looked for in titles, abstracts and keywords of articles. Initially 250 articles were identified. Of these 121 papers (58.4%) were not directly related to the purpose of this survey and 129 one (51.6%) were relevant. In this sense, four categories of approaches were noticeable. These categories, included: climatic-environmental approach; hygienic-health approach; conservative-ecological approach and planning-management approach. According to our survey, Conservative & Ecological is a variable approach (37.21%). Others are Management & planning approach (28.68%), Climatic & Environmental approach (22.48%) and hygienic-health approach (11.63%) respectively. This emphasis on contemporary articles can be justified by ecological concerns within the last decay. Articles, mostly interested in conserver & supplier function of open space throw public demand and give emphasize to natural spaces in order to manage the use of open space and to shape the build environment growth direction. The results of this article indicate the increase attention to the planning- management and conservation-ecological approaches in open spaces especially from years 2007-2008, these pieces of research often consider open spaces beyond inner city spaces such as those in suburbia and rural areas. Recent priorities in research issues are the methods, models and the influences of each urban-regional planning and management decision on supplying key roles of open spaces and the most important ones, the protective role.
